2005 Ford Focus vs. 2011 Fiat Sedici

To start off, 2011 Fiat Sedici is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Ford Focus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Ford Focus would be higher. At 1,910 cc (4 cylinders), 2011 Fiat Sedici is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Fiat Sedici (119 HP @ 3500 RPM) has 20 more horse power than 2005 Ford Focus. (99 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Fiat Sedici should accelerate faster than 2005 Ford Focus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Ford Focus weights approximately 52 kg more than 2011 Fiat Sedici.

Because 2011 Fiat Sedici is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Ford Focus.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Fiat Sedici will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2011 Fiat Sedici (280 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 135 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Ford Focus. (145 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2011 Fiat Sedici will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Ford Focus.
